Commit d8bae838 authored by Luca Cinquini's avatar Luca Cinquini
Browse files

Changing how Tomcat is started in the IdP.

parent 65a4bea5
Loading
Loading
Loading
Loading
+20 −0
Original line number Diff line number Diff line
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<!-- This file contains a list of aliases for ESGF search facets. -->
<aliases xmlns="http://www.esgf.org/whitelist">

    <set>
       <value>project</value>
       <value>model_cohort</value>
    </set>

    <set>
       <value>project</value>
       <value>model_cohort</value>
    </set>

    <set>
       <value>activity</value>
       <value>experiment_family</value>
    </set>

</aliases>
+3 −1
Original line number Diff line number Diff line
@@ -17,4 +17,6 @@ RUN cd /usr/local/tomcat/webapps/esgf-idp/ && \

# run Tomcat as non-privileged user
USER tomcat
ENTRYPOINT ["/usr/local/tomcat/bin/catalina.sh", "run"]
COPY scripts/docker-entrypoint.sh /usr/local/bin/docker-entrypoint.sh
ENTRYPOINT ["/usr/local/bin/docker-entrypoint.sh"]
#ENTRYPOINT ["/usr/local/tomcat/bin/catalina.sh", "run"]
+6 −0
Original line number Diff line number Diff line
#!/bin/sh
# script that starts Tomcat then keeps the container running
#
/usr/local/tomcat/bin/catalina.sh start
#
tail -f /dev/null